A system for person-independent classification of hand postures against complex backgrounds in video images is presented. The system employs elastic graph matching, which has already been successfully applied for object and face recognition. We use the bunch graph technique to model variance in hand posture appearance between different subjects and variance in backgrounds. Our system does not need a separate segmentation stage but closely integrates finding the object boundaries with posture classification. 相似文献

Abstract. This contribution introduces MOBSY, a fully integrated, autonomous mobile service robot system. It acts as an automatic dialogue-based
receptionist for visitors to our institute. MOBSY incorporates many techniques from different research areas into one working
stand-alone system. The techniques involved range from computer vision over speech understanding to classical robotics.
Along with the two main aspects of vision and speech, we also focus on the integration aspect, both on the methodological
and on the technical level. We describe the task and the techniques involved. Finally, we discuss the experiences that we
gained with MOBSY during a live performance at our institute. 相似文献

It is well recognized that performance changes over time. However, the effect of these changes on overall assessments of performance is largely unknown. In a laboratory experiment, we examined the influence of salient Gestalt characteristics of a dynamic performance profile on supervisory ratings. We manipulated performance trend (flat, linear-improving, linear-deteriorating, U-shaped, and ∩-shaped), performance variation (small, large), and performance mean (negative, zero, positive) within subjects and display format (graphic, tabular) between subjects. Participants received and evaluated information about the weekly performance of different employees over a simulated 26-week period. Results showed strong main effects on performance ratings of both performance mean and performance trend, as well as interactions with display format. Theoretical and practical implications of the results are discussed. (PsycINFO Database Record (c) 2010 APA, all rights reserved) 相似文献

Awareness of the construction environment can be improved by automatic three-dimensional (3D) sensing and modeling of job sites in real time. Commercially available 3D modeling approaches based on range scanning techniques are capable of modeling static objects only, and thus cannot model dynamic objects in real time in an environment comprised of moving humans, equipment, and materials. Emerging prototype video range cameras offer an alternative by facilitating affordable, wide field of view, dynamic object tracking at frame rates better than 1?Hz (real time). This paper describes a methodology to model, detect, and track the position of static and moving objects in real time, based on data obtained from video range cameras. Experiments with this technology have produced results that indicate that video rate 3D data acquisition and analysis of construction environments can support effective modeling, detection, and tracking of project resources. This approach to job site awareness has inherent value and broad application. In combination with effective management practices and other sensing techniques, this technology has the potential to significantly improve safety on construction job sites. 相似文献

We determined the nucleotide sequence of the SH gene its flanking regions over a range of 380 nucleotides for three distinct mumps virus (MUV) isolates. Two isolates from the 1992 mumps epidemic in Western Switzerland and one MUV isolated in 1995 in the same geographic area have been analyzed and compared to 16 recently published SH nucleotide sequences and their presumed amino acid sequences. The nucleotide sequences from the 1992 MUV isolates were identical and closely related to two MUV strains from Eastern Switzerland and strains from the U.K. The MUV isolated in 1995 is clearly different from all other strains. 相似文献

First, annual cost of electronic filing of medical images were calculated and compared with that of film storage in two hospitals under different conditions. Storage of medical images using a pixel size of 100 microns x 100 microns and 2-byte depth on the 130 mm, 650 MB magneto-optical disks costs with four times as much as the cost for film storage. However, 175 microns x 175 microns 12 bits combined with implementation of lossless compression would reduce the cost to a level equal to that for films storage. Doubled or tripled densities of MOD will improve the cost ever further. Second, the effectiveness of Hospital Information System/Radiological Information System (HIS/RIS) was evaluated. Examination time, film delivery time and the total turn-around time was markedly shortened by more than 23 hours on average. Our measurement method employing IC cards in pre-post HIS/RIS/PACS procedures is generally applicable to other hospitals. Third, to determine the optimal method of maximizing the efficacy of diagnostic imaging, 260 questionnaires were sent to the staff of 13 university hospitals. Every situation was described by both a radiologist and the physician who ordered the examination and received the reports and images. The level of technical efficacy and diagnostic accuracy of radiology strongly influenced the diagnostic thought processes of the physician. 相似文献
